Output 3d8913758ef4570efe8833520b67bfcc30badb799446935f677df28937a0689e:1

value
12726293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1033613222d97ae81a9593218fa0e56c381d2f85 OP_EQUAL
address
M9NpbRQaduj8u7HU6hLHGATfZXV7oGDc5w
transaction
3d8913758ef4570efe8833520b67bfcc30badb799446935f677df28937a0689e
spent
true